What is a boat manager?

Boat Managers are professionals responsible for overseeing the operations, maintenance, and crew of a vessel. Their duties typically include ensuring the boat is seaworthy, managing schedules and budgets, supervising staff, and coordinating repairs and safety checks. Boat Managers work on various types of vessels, such as yachts, ferries, or commercial boats, and play a crucial role in ensuring smooth and safe operations. They often communicate with owners, harbor authorities, and suppliers to keep the boat running efficiently.

What is the difference between Boat Manager vs Marine Technician?

AspectBoat ManagerMarine Technician
CredentialsCertifications in management, boating safety, and sometimes marine operationsCertifications in marine technology, engine repair, and maintenance
Work EnvironmentOffice settings, yacht or boat facilities, overseeing operationsWorkshop, boatyard, or onboard vessels performing repairs and diagnostics
Employer & IndustryYacht clubs, private boat owners, marinasMarinas, boat repair shops, marine service companies
Search & Comparison IntentUnderstanding management roles in boatingTechnical repair and maintenance skills in marine industry

The main difference between a Boat Manager and a Marine Technician lies in their focus: Boat Managers oversee operations, logistics, and client relations, often requiring management certifications. Marine Technicians specialize in repairing and maintaining marine engines and systems, with technical certifications. Both roles are essential in the boating industry but serve different functions based on skills and responsibilities.

Job description

POSITION SUMMARY:
The Boat Services Manager is under the supervision of the Boat Manager. This role will manage and provide daily direction to the associates in the Boat Service area within a Bass Pro Shops or Free-Standing Store to include inventory control, service, warranty, rigging, delivery, detail and parts activities.
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S:
  • Supports the Boat Manager in the achievement of the departments or dealership's financial goals for the Service area to include Service and Parts Sales, Gross Margin, Inventory Shrinkage and Payroll Goals.
  • Provides daily supervision and direction to the associates in the Service Department.
  • Schedules and assigns all service, rigging and warranty work orders; ensure work orders are completed to the customer's satisfaction on a timely basis.
  • Maintains and constantly strives to increase associate productivity.
  • Maintains a safe, clean and secure work environment.
  • Supports a strong commitment to world class customer service and ensure a pleasant and productive shopping experience for all customers.
  • Assists the Boat Manager to staff the Service area with customer-oriented associates; participate in interviewing and makes recommendations for selection; coordinate training; consults with Boat Manager and gives input on preparation of performance appraisals; prepares weekly work schedules; coaches and motivates associates to promote positive customer relations and a productive team-oriented work environment.
  • Resolves customer and associate opportunities with Boat Manager.
  • Assists the Boat Manager with coordination of all "Special Events" to include Boat Shows, Classic events and / or other on or off-site promotional activities.
  • Manages and ensures accuracy of unit and parts inventories.
  • Ensures warranty claims are created, submitted and warranty payments received on a timely basis.
  • Ensures products are properly detailed and unit deliveries are conducted in a friendly and professional manner as scheduled.
  • Assists the Boat Manager in executing other Supervisory responsibilities in accordance with the Company's policies and applicable laws, including interviewing; training; planning; assigning and directing work; measuring and evaluating performance; addressing complaints and resolving problems; maintaining a positive, harassment free working environment for all associates.
  • ALL OTHER DUTIES AS ASSIGNED.

EXPERIENCE/QUALIFICATIONS:
  • Experience: 2-4 years in Retail Boating or similar industry; Supervisory experience is a plus

KNOWLEDGE, SKILLS AND ABILITY:
  • Ability to calculate figures and amounts such as discounts, commissions, and percentages
  • Ability to read and analyze certain reports
  • Ability to effectively present information and respond to questions from Managers, associates, customers, and the public
  • Ability to conduct meetings and presentations to groups
  • Proficiency with PC-based word processing, spreadsheets, data based management and electronic point of sale and inventory management systems
  • Demonstrated strong interpersonal skills
  • Ability to establish and maintain effective working relationships with co-workers, associates, customers and with the Corporate Staff

TRAVEL REQUIREMENTS:
  • N/A

PHYSICAL REQUIREMENTS:
  • Regularly performs computer work, walks and stands
  • Occasionally sits and lifts up to 50lbs

INDEPENDENT JUDGEMENT:
  • Performs duties within scope of general company policies, procedures, and objectives. Analyzes problems and performs needs assessments. Uses judgment in adapting broad guidelines to achieve desired result. Regular exercise of independent judgment within accepted practices. Makes recommendations that affect policies, procedures, and practices.
